Pair Large Relief Cast Japanese Solid Bronze Vases 13"

This is a magnificent & large pair of Oriental / Japanese Bronze vases, cast in relief, & dating to the early part of the 20th Century.

The vases have been hot cast in solid Bronze, & are not modern, cold cast (bronze resin) reproductions.

The vases are baluster in form on a pedestal base, with a scalloped, flower like, rim and stylised Eagle & Serpent figural handles.

The body has been cast with a symmetrical Oriental design with a foliate border to the shoulders & base. The front & rear have an ovoid panel, with a branch & leaf border, containing a high relief casting of two birds flying around a flowering branch.

The neck has a cast, stylised dragon? motif to each side, with applied handles consisting of a Eagles? head with a serpent in it's mouth.

Condition is very good. The main points to note are that the base on one vase has had a slight knock, which has left a very slight split in the bronze (which does not affect its integrity in any way - please see photo), there is a very slight casting mark to the relief decoration on one side & one relief panel has a slight knock (very difficult to see, & again, does not affect the vase in any way).

The vases are approx 13 1/4" in height (approx 33.7cm), & are very heavy, weighing around 3.5 Kg unpacked (one vase is 1.645 KG & the other 1.760 Kg).

Overall, a magnificent pair of Japanese Bronze vases.
